Transaction 78b395498215268a6f066e3700b29641cd4460cf70fcaf629aef5521392999c3
1 Input
1 Output
-
78b395498215268a6f066e3700b29641cd4460cf70fcaf629aef5521392999c3:0
- value
- 4066186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bbd900488e27c986c1a059d3bdf426f5098dd3d OP_EQUAL
- address
- 3FtVkKGCfcnpr9xpyyPChby9VJY3LGFGsb